How much do influencer ass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for influencer assistant in Florida is $18.90,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.55 and $21.26 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the main challenges an influencer assistant might encounter when managing multiple brand collaborations?

One of the primary challenges for an Influencer Assistant is balancing the demands of several brand partnerships simultaneously. This often involves coordinating content calendars, ensuring deliverables meet each brand's unique guidelines, and handling last-minute changes from either the influencer or the brand. Strong organizational skills and clear communication are essential to prevent scheduling conflicts and to maintain positive relationships with both the influencer and external partners. Being adaptable and proactive in problem-solving helps ensure campaigns run smoothly and deadlines are consistently met.

What does an influencer assistant do?

Influencer assistants work with other social media influencers to support various marketing and brand awareness efforts. In this role, you may research target audiences, determine which social media platforms to focus on, and help create a guide or program for influencers to follow. You may also manage public relations events, organize a database that analyzes media outreach, and track industry trends. While you may perform several administrative tasks, this position is more than an administrative role. Influencer assistants are an essential part of the marketing team that helps a company get the broadest outreach possible for its products and services.

What is an influencer assistant?

Influencer Assistants are professionals who support social media influencers with various tasks to help grow and manage their online presence. Their duties often include scheduling posts, handling communications, managing collaborations, organizing content, and sometimes assisting with photo or video shoots. They play a crucial role in streamlining the influencer's workflow, allowing the influencer to focus on content creation and audience engagement. Influencer Assistants need strong organizational, communication, and digital skills to be effective in their roles.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an influencer ass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Influencer Assistant, you need strong organizational skills, social media proficiency, and experience with content scheduling, often supported by a background in marketing, communications, or a related field. Familiarity with tools like Canva, Hootsuite, Google Workspace, and various social media management platforms is typically required. Excellent communication, adaptability, and attention to detail are crucial soft skills that help manage dynamic workflows and relationships. These abilities ensure the influencer’s brand runs smoothly, content is delivered on time, and collaborations are executed professionally.
